About This File

The BAT's architecture was inspired by a real building of this kind, built in Warsaw around 1973/1974 and designed by the Swedish architect Sten Samuelson. However it was not meant to be exact replica, there are also some differences.
In game entire set offer 3000 parking places.

NO DEPENDENCIES.

Tested and found to work as specified.

Suggestion: clean up the download zip file. The .sav files are temporaries and should be dropped. When I put this in my plugins, I consolidated all the pieces into one .dat file using File2DAT by ilive, and eliminated two of the lower directories. This produced a very nice add to my miscellaneous transport menu.
